How Far From Keota to ...

We spend a lot of time looking through Gazetteers & Almanacs that were published in the late 1800's and early 1900's. Many of the Gazetteers include the distance from a town such as Keota to various places of note, such as the White House.

With a nod to our favorite Gazetteers, the straight-line distance beginning in Keota and extending to:

  • Greeley, which is the Seat of Weld County, lies 39 miles [62.8 km]<1> to the west southwest. If you could walk a straight line from Keota to Greeley, with an average speed<5> of 2.2 miles [3.5 km] per hour, it would take over two days to make the trip. A horse and buggy averaging 3.2 miles [5.1 km] per hour would take just about two full days.
  • Denver, which is the State Capital of Colorado, lies 82 miles [132 km] to the southwest (SW). Driving, with an average speed of 63 miles [101.4 km] per hour, would take less than two hours, a buggy would take most of three days and walking would take 5 days.
  • The White House (Washington, DC) is 1,434 miles [2,307.8 km] to the east (E). Driving would take most of three days, a buggy would take 56 days and walking would take 82 days.

<6>The shortest line can be visualized by stretching a string on a Globe from Point A to Point B - this is known as a Great Circle Route. Where you might expect the shortest route from Keota to the Middle East to be East and South, the Great Circle Route actually lies to the North and East.
